Recognizing Roofing System Setup Expenses



When you think of roof setup prices, it's necessary to comprehend the numerous aspects that can affect the final price. Initially, consider the type of roof covering material you want. Alternatives like asphalt tiles, steel roof covering, or floor tiles each included their own price points.

The intricacy of your roof layout also contributes; an easy saddleback roof is normally less expensive to install than a multi-layered or elaborate design.

Next off, consider the dimension of your roof covering. Larger roofing systems require even more products and labor, dramatically affecting the overall price. Your location can not be ignored either; labor rates and material availability vary between areas, which can impact your spending plan.

Additionally, timing matters. Roofer could've seasonal fluctuations in rates, and hiring throughout peak times can bring about greater expenses.

Finally, do not forget possible licenses and inspections, which are often essential relying on your regional laws. Recognizing these elements will aid you establish a practical budget plan and plan for the investment in your house.

Budgeting for Your Roof Task



Budgeting for your roofing task is vital to avoid unforeseen costs and economic strain. Begin by examining your needs; take into consideration the sort of products you desire, the size of your roofing system, and any kind of additional attributes like skylights or ventilation systems. Research study the typical costs in your location to get a practical concept of what to expect.

When you have a standard quote, add a barrier-- typically around 10-15% for unexpected concerns such as hidden damage or boosted material expenses.

Do not forget to factor in labor expenses, which can vary substantially depending on the intricacy of your roof and the professional you select.

Next off, think about any kind of licenses or examination costs. It's a good idea to account for these in advance to avoid shocks later on.

If you're financing the task, consider funding choices or layaway plan that suit your budget plan. Set a clear timeline and stick to it to stop costs from rising.

Finally, track all costs and receipts throughout the procedure. This will help you stay arranged and make adjustments as required.
